I never knew the RAF had women pilots back then. Were they combat or just flying them between bases etc?
|
Kieran27 - 2015-06-24 No combat pilots as far as I know, the women were only allowed to do ferry service for planes. Flying them from factories and airfields to the front lines, and then flying back damaged planes for repair. Still pretty dangerous duty as enemy pilots would only see an allied plane, not who was piloting it.
That was the RAF though. Russia had actual women combat pilots during WWII.
